The Cessna T206 Turbo Stationair represents the modern evolution of one of general aviation's most enduring utility aircraft designs, serving as a high-altitude capable workhorse for personal and business flying. First flown in August 1996, it is a high-wing single-engine aircraft powered by a turbocharged Lycoming engine that seats six occupants. The aircraft spans over 35 feet in wingspan and delivers more than 300 horsepower through its TIO-540-AJ1A powerplant. Manufacturing resumed at Cessna Aircraft Company's Independence, Kansas facility after a 12-year production hiatus. AviatorDB tracks 80,556 Cessna aircraft currently registered in the FAA database. The ICAO type designator for this aircraft model is T206.
